An exhibition dedicated to children from frontline territories of Ukraine has opened in Ukrinform

Kyiv, Ukraine.

On the 4th of July 2016, an exhibition “Children in war” has opened in Ukrinform with the support of BO, “Balto-Chornomorskyy Blagodiynyy Fond” (the Baltic-Black Sea Charity Fund).

At the press conference dedicated to this occasion, there were discussions about helping children from the frontline territories and psychological adaptation of those who were forced to leave their homes in Donbas.

“The photo-exhibition “Children in War” is a result of travels and a few years of living in the territories that are located in the frontline area of Luhansk and Donetsk regions, particularly Stanytsia Luhanska, Mar’inka and Avdiivka. It is a result of communications within the medium of global projects with teachers and students, who made a decision to stay there for different reasons. It is an attempt to show that life goes on in these territories despite any circumstances, such as gunfire and everyday shootings. Children laugh, cry, study and have their own problems…” . The projects realised by the Fund are “investments in future” of their own kind. We want to build a foundation of peaceful life within the unified and successful Ukraine. Nowadays, 10 thousand students continue to go to school within the 30-kilometre frontline zone of Donbas.

One of the photographers, Nina Grushetska, also participated in the press-conference.

After the exhibition demonstration in Ukrinform, “Children in War” is planned to be shown in the countries of Baltic region and Europe.
